Well what a night in Leavenworth Kansas,

It saw Big Daddy Fullz back in action as well as Sean Knight and The Iceman teaming up again for a Players Club Reunion. The Griz retained His Heavyweight Title and The Commish took a leave of absence during the show. Due to Miss Nancy's illness.

Here are the results.


Match #1
Chip Douglas defeated Hype Gotti and two others in a fatel four way match with some exciting Cruiserweight action.


Match #2
Showtime Darren Sanders was defeated by Big Daddy Fullz, after the Match Fullz got on the mic and demanded that he get some competion with that being said The Griz came out and said I will give you some, then Commish Decker steps up to the plate and said that they would fight, but they would do it as the main event that night and the winner would take all.


Match #3
Krow defeated Babyface and retained his TXW Cruiserweight belt, lots of good  spots in this match.


Match #4
The Iceman vs. Devan Scott and Posse, it was back and forth for awhile and when Devan threw Iceman out of the ring the Posse started beating on him, then without warning Sean Knight showed up and started Kicking butt, Acting Commish Rich Allen steped up and said when not make this a tag match and so it was on the match was going back and forth and the Devan and his partner got the upper hand and when theu went to throw Sean into the ropes where Devan was waiting with a chain, Sean reversed it and Devan knocked out his own partner, when he stood up and turned around Sean Knight finished him with a Superkick and got the win for him and the Iceman.


Match #5
Kid USA and T Bone Vs Thanatos and #1 Bret Young, this was a match for the ages, Bret and Thanatos got the upper hand first , I will tell you fans this Thanatos can move like lighting and i have never seen Knife hand chops so quick and powerful EVER. They where so Powerful that the ring broke in a couple of places. This match had some really great spots and finally Kid Usa and T Bone pulled out of it with a win, but that win came with some great punishment that they will not soon forget.


Match #6
The Griz Vs Big Daddy Fullz. This match was a great match and we saw some great moves by both opponents. Just when Griz thought he had the match Big Daddy came back with a great frogsplash and would have one it, but Rich Allen came  to the ring with a Chair and was going to hit The Griz but alas he moved and SuperStar crowned Big Daddy Fullz on the head knocking him out and Griz moved in quickly and got the pinfall and the victory over Big Daddy for the fist time ever.
